From mboxrd@z Thu Jan 1 00:00:00 1970 From: Yann E. MORIN Date: Sun, 1 Apr 2018 14:27:11 +0200 Subject: [Buildroot] [PATCH 2/2] package/pkg-golang: drop the fixed _BINDIR variable In-Reply-To: <20180401115136.1345-2-thomas.petazzoni@bootlin.com> References: <20180401115136.1345-1-thomas.petazzoni@bootlin.com> <20180401115136.1345-2-thomas.petazzoni@bootlin.com> Message-ID: <20180401122711.GC2613@scaer> List-Id: M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: buildroot@busybox.net Thomas, All, On 2018-04-01 13:51 +0200, Thomas Petazzoni spake thusly: > Now that _BINDIR is always "bin", having it as a package variable > doesn't make much sense, so get rid of this variable completely, and > use "bin". > > Signed-off-by: Thomas Petazzoni Reviewed-by: "Yann E. MORIN" Regards, Yann E. MORIN. > --- > package/docker-proxy/docker-proxy.mk | 2 +- > package/flannel/flannel.mk | 2 +- > package/pkg-golang.mk | 5 ++--- > 3 files changed, 4 insertions(+), 5 deletions(-) > > diff --git a/package/docker-proxy/docker-proxy.mk b/package/docker-proxy/docker-proxy.mk > index a90271fc35..dfa9d4347d 100644 > --- a/package/docker-proxy/docker-proxy.mk > +++ b/package/docker-proxy/docker-proxy.mk > @@ -17,7 +17,7 @@ DOCKER_PROXY_WORKSPACE = gopath > DOCKER_PROXY_BUILD_TARGETS = cmd/proxy > > define DOCKER_PROXY_INSTALL_TARGET_CMDS > - $(INSTALL) -D -m 0755 $(@D)/$(DOCKER_PROXY_BINDIR)/proxy $(TARGET_DIR)/usr/bin/docker-proxy > + $(INSTALL) -D -m 0755 $(@D)/bin/proxy $(TARGET_DIR)/usr/bin/docker-proxy > endef > > $(eval $(golang-package)) > diff --git a/package/flannel/flannel.mk b/package/flannel/flannel.mk > index 07d5d0dfd6..d00d2df92c 100644 > --- a/package/flannel/flannel.mk > +++ b/package/flannel/flannel.mk > @@ -15,7 +15,7 @@ FLANNEL_LDFLAGS = -X github.com/coreos/flannel/version.Version=$(FLANNEL_VERSION > > # Install flannel to its well known location. > define FLANNEL_INSTALL_TARGET_CMDS > - $(INSTALL) -D -m 0755 $(@D)/$(FLANNEL_BINDIR)/flannel $(TARGET_DIR)/opt/bin/flanneld > + $(INSTALL) -D -m 0755 $(@D)/bin/flannel $(TARGET_DIR)/opt/bin/flanneld > $(INSTALL) -D -m 0755 $(@D)/dist/mk-docker-opts.sh $(TARGET_DIR)/opt/bin/mk-docker-opts.sh > endef > > diff --git a/package/pkg-golang.mk b/package/pkg-golang.mk > index c21be86a55..5891317b60 100644 > --- a/package/pkg-golang.mk > +++ b/package/pkg-golang.mk > @@ -70,7 +70,6 @@ ifeq ($$($(2)_BUILD_TARGETS),.) > $(2)_BIN_NAME ?= $(1) > endif > > -$(2)_BINDIR = bin > $(2)_INSTALL_BINS ?= $(1) > > # Source files in Go should be extracted in a precise folder in the hierarchy > @@ -103,7 +102,7 @@ define $(2)_BUILD_CMDS > GOPATH="$$(@D)/$$($(2)_WORKSPACE)" \ > $$($(2)_GO_ENV) \ > $$(GO_BIN) build -v $$($(2)_BUILD_OPTS) \ > - -o $$(@D)/$$($(2)_BINDIR)/$$(if $$($(2)_BIN_NAME),$$($(2)_BIN_NAME),$$(notdir $$(d))) \ > + -o $$(@D)/bin/$$(if $$($(2)_BIN_NAME),$$($(2)_BIN_NAME),$$(notdir $$(d))) \ > ./$$(d) > ) > endef > @@ -114,7 +113,7 @@ endif > ifndef $(2)_INSTALL_TARGET_CMDS > define $(2)_INSTALL_TARGET_CMDS > $$(foreach d,$$($(2)_INSTALL_BINS),\ > - $(INSTALL) -D -m 0755 $$(@D)/$$($(2)_BINDIR)/$$(d) $(TARGET_DIR)/usr/bin/$$(d) > + $(INSTALL) -D -m 0755 $$(@D)/bin/$$(d) $(TARGET_DIR)/usr/bin/$$(d) > ) > endef > endif > -- > 2.14.3 > > _______________________________________________ > buildroot mailing list > buildroot at busybox.net > http://lists.busybox.net/mailman/listinfo/buildroot -- .-----------------.--------------------.------------------.--------------------. | Yann E. MORIN | Real-Time Embedded | /"\ ASCII RIBBON | Erics' conspiracy: | | +33 662 376 056 | Software Designer | \ / CAMPAIGN | ___ | | +33 223 225 172 `------------.-------: X AGAINST | \e/ There is no | | http://ymorin.is-a-geek.org/ | _/*\_ | / \ HTML MAIL | v conspiracy. | '------------------------------^-------^------------------^--------------------'